What is a Structured Letter Of Credit?

In international trade transactions, where parties seek secure payment mechanisms, a Structured Letter of Credit serves as a crucial financial instrument. This document, governed by Malaysian law and regulated by Bank Negara Malaysia, provides payment assurance to sellers while offering buyers the security of document verification before payment. The Structured Letter of Credit is particularly valuable in cross-border transactions where parties may not have established trading relationships or where regulatory requirements necessitate formal banking channels. It includes detailed specifications for payment conditions, required documentation, and compliance requirements, all structured within the framework of UCP 600 and Malaysian banking regulations.

What sections should be included in a Structured Letter Of Credit?

1. Letter Reference and Date: Unique reference number and issuance date of the Letter of Credit

2. Issuing Bank Details: Complete details of the bank issuing the Letter of Credit

3. Beneficiary Information: Full name and address of the party receiving payment under the Letter of Credit

4. Applicant Information: Full name and address of the party requesting the Letter of Credit

5. Credit Amount and Currency: Specification of the maximum amount and currency of the Letter of Credit

6. Form of Credit: Whether the credit is irrevocable or confirmed

7. Expiry Date and Place: Validity period and location where the credit expires

8. Document Presentation Terms: Specifications for where and how documents should be presented

9. Payment Terms: Conditions and timing of payment including sight, deferred payment, or acceptance

10. Required Documents: List of documents that must be presented for payment

11. Shipment Terms: Details of shipment including latest shipment date and partial shipments

12. General Terms and Conditions: Standard terms governing the Letter of Credit including UCP 600 reference

What sections are optional to include in a Structured Letter Of Credit?

1. Transferability Clause: Section specifying whether and how the credit may be transferred to another beneficiary

2. Revolving Credit Terms: Terms for automatically reinstating the credit amount, used in ongoing trading relationships

3. Red Clause Provisions: Terms for advance payment to the beneficiary before document presentation

4. Green Clause Provisions: Terms for advance payment against warehouse receipts

5. Back-to-Back Arrangements: Terms for using the credit as security for issuing another credit

6. Confirmation Instructions: Instructions regarding confirmation by another bank

7. Special Conditions: Any unique requirements or conditions specific to the transaction

What schedules should be included in a Structured Letter Of Credit?

1. Schedule A - Document Requirements: Detailed list and specifications of required documents including format and content requirements

2. Schedule B - Goods Description: Detailed description of the goods or services covered by the Letter of Credit

3. Schedule C - Payment Schedule: Detailed payment terms and installment schedule if applicable

4. Appendix 1 - Bank Forms: Standard forms required by the issuing bank for document presentation

5. Appendix 2 - Special Instructions: Specific instructions for document preparation and presentation

6. Appendix 3 - Fee Schedule: Detailed breakdown of all applicable banking fees and charges
